Cul-de-sac acreage with natural boundary | Bushfire overlay present | Lifestyle buyer demand | Tamborine Mountain outlook This property is a rare find in a tightly held estate, offering a generous 1.44-hectare lot that backs directly onto protected natural surrounds, ensuring a private and tranquil setting with an outlook toward Tamborine Mountain. Its cul-de-sac position within a low-density acreage market makes it particularly suited to lifestyle buyers seeking space, privacy, and a semi-rural feel without sacrificing proximity to the hinterland’s amenities. The configuration is premium for its area, as the natural boundary cannot be built out, which preserves the outlook and adds a layer of exclusivity that standard acreage paddocks lack. This property best serves owner-occupiers planning a custom build who prioritise a natural setting and long-term privacy. The bushfire overlay exposure is a material factor that may influence both construction costs and insurance premiums, and it should be carefully evaluated when forming a view on price. While the lot is free from flood or heritage overlays, the bushfire risk may require specific building standards and vegetation management that could affect the overall budget and timeline for development. The absence of an existing dwelling means the buyer must account for the full cost of a new build, and the acreage size may also involve higher ongoing maintenance expenses compared to a standard suburban lot. These considerations should be weighed against the property’s strong lifestyle appeal and protected setting.

Market Insight

Benobble is a tightly held rural locality, defined by its low population and very limited turnover, creating a niche market. Demand is driven by families seeking a lifestyle on acreage properties, with recent sales indicating a premium for this seclusion. The market is characterised by extremely low transaction volumes, which constrains liquidity and price discovery, presenting a significant risk for buyers reliant on market momentum.
